About PDF Text Editor Tool
PDF Text Editor enables adding custom text overlays to PDF documents for corrections, annotations, translations, or supplementary information. Using pdf.js for page rendering and pdf-lib for text embedding, the tool provides drag-and-drop text box positioning with font size control (12-32px) and full color customization. All editing occurs client-side in browser without requiring document upload to external servers, ensuring complete privacy when annotating confidential reports, legal documents, or sensitive materials.
This solution serves translators overlaying translations on foreign-language documents, educators adding instructions to worksheets, form fillers completing non-editable PDFs, and professionals annotating scanned documents lacking OCR text. Whether adding missing labels to diagrams, inserting corrections to printed materials, completing government forms without printing, or adding multilingual captions to images, the tool delivers text-enhanced PDFs without Adobe Acrobat subscriptions.
Technical Capabilities
- ▸Drag-and-Drop Text Positioning: HTML5 drag API enables pixel-precise text placement. Click-hold box border to move freely across page—browser coordinate system ensures accurate positioning.
- ▸Six Font Sizes: 12px to 32px range accommodates fine-print annotations (12px), normal text (14-16px), headings (20-24px), and emphasis (32px). Scale selection per text box.
- ▸Full Color Palette: HTML5 color picker provides 16.7 million colors. Each text box independently colored—enables color-coding by topic, urgency, or annotation type.
- ▸Live Preview Editing: Text boxes render as semi-transparent overlays during editing. Visual WYSIWYG confirmation shows exact final appearance before saving.
- ▸Multi-Page Support: Navigate PDF pages with prev/next controls. Add text boxes to any page—tool tracks which page contains each box for proper embedding.
- ▸Searchable Embedded Text: pdf-lib embeds text using Helvetica font as actual PDF text (not images). Fully searchable, selectable, accessible to assistive technologies.
- ▸Text Box Management: Sidebar lists all added text boxes with page numbers and content preview. Quick deletion via hover-reveal delete buttons—streamlines editing workflow.
Professional Use Cases
Document Translation Overlay
Add translated text overlays to foreign-language documents. Position translations near original text without editing source—maintains original for reference.
Form Filling Without Printing
Complete non-editable PDF forms digitally by adding text boxes over blank fields. Submit forms electronically without printing, handwriting, scanning cycle.
Scanned Document Annotation
Add searchable text to image-based scanned PDFs lacking OCR. Make scanned documents keyword-searchable by overlaying text transcriptions.
Diagram and Blueprint Labeling
Add labels, callouts, and annotations to technical diagrams, architectural blueprints, or engineering schematics. Color-code by system or priority.
Educational Worksheet Customization
Teachers add instructions, hints, or modifications to existing worksheets. Personalize materials for different student levels without recreating entire document.
Error Correction and Updates
Add correction overlays to printed materials containing errors. Cover typos or outdated information with correct text—faster than reprinting entire document.